Description
Ipomoea pauciflora is a distinctive perennial shrub belonging to the Convolvulaceae family. Unlike the common climbing vines in the Ipomoea genus, this species has evolved into a woody plant form, making it a botanical outlier and a fascinating subject for adaptation studies in arid environments.
The species originates from the dry tropical regions of Mexico. It is specifically adapted to the semi-arid deciduous forests of its native range, where it has developed specialized mechanisms to survive long-term drought, high temperatures, and intense solar radiation, often shedding its leaves to conserve moisture.
Botanically, Ipomoea pauciflora is characterized by a lignified stem structure and deep taproot system. Its leaves are usually smaller and more leathery than those of common morning glories, which helps in preventing excessive transpiration. The flowers maintain the classic funnel shape, though they appear in lower density compared to other related species, reflecting the plant's strategy of resource allocation.
Regarding cultivation, this plant requires strict adherence to its ecological needs. It thrives in well-draining, sandy, or rocky soils that prevent root rot. It does not tolerate heavy clay or moisture-retentive substrates. The primary agrotechnical challenge involves providing optimal water balance; irrigation should be sparse and provided only during active growth stages, ensuring the substrate dries out completely between cycles.
The host of potential uses for this plant includes xeriscaping and soil conservation in dry climates. While it is not a large-scale agricultural crop, it serves as a resilient component in specialized botanical gardens and sustainable landscape projects. Common pests include aphids and mites, which can be managed with standard integrated pest management practices, while fungal diseases are almost exclusively caused by excessive humidity levels in the soil or air.
